Federal Tax Obligation Credits



Federal tax debts function as a significant financial motivation for homeowners and organizations thinking about the installation of photovoltaic panels. Solar Installation. These credit scores, primarily offered through the government Investment Tax Debt (ITC), permit people to deduct a percentage of the expense of their solar energy system from their government taxes. Since 2023, the ITC offers a 30% credit rating, making solar power extra enticing and budget friendly. This tax obligation advantage not only reduces the upfront monetary problem however also increases the return on investment. By making the most of government tax credit histories, residential property proprietors can boost their overall financial savings, making solar energy systems a monetarily smart selection. Such motivations play a necessary duty in promoting sustainable energy adoption throughout the country


State Incentives Programs



Along with government tax credit scores, several states supply their very own reward programs targeted at motivating the adoption of solar power. These programs can take various kinds, including rebates, performance-based rewards, and tax debts that even more minimize the general price of solar panel installation. States such as California, New York City, and Massachusetts have applied robust programs designed to enhance access to solar innovation. Furthermore, some states provide net metering plans, permitting property owners to get credit histories for excess energy generated by their solar systems. These motivations not just promote ecological sustainability however likewise make solar energy extra economically sensible for consumers. Understanding and leveraging these state rewards can greatly enhance the roi for solar power systems.

Low Maintenance and Durability of Solar Panels



One significant advantage of solar panels is their reduced maintenance needs and remarkable longevity. When set up, solar panels generally call official site for marginal maintenance, primarily restricted to regular cleaning to remove dirt and debris that may influence performance. Unlike conventional power systems, there are no moving parts in photovoltaic panels, which lowers the likelihood of mechanical failures and the demand for frequent repair work.


Most solar panels come with warranties ranging from 20 to 25 years, mirroring their durability and long-term performance. Several manufacturers declare that panels can remain to produce power properly for three decades or more, making them an audio investment for companies and property owners alike. This long life not only assures prolonged power cost savings however also adds to a sustainable power future. The combination of reduced upkeep and a long life expectancy makes solar panels an appealing choice for those seeking trustworthy power services.

Ingenious Solar Materials



The development of solar innovation continues with the introduction of ingenious materials that enhance efficiency and performance. Current innovations include the development of perovskite solar batteries, which supply greater conversion rates and lower production costs contrasted to typical silicon-based cells. These materials are versatile and lightweight, enabling diverse applications, such as combination into structure products. In addition, bifacial photovoltaic panels, which capture sunshine from both sides, are getting traction, more raising power output. Nanotechnology is also being made use of to produce coverings that improve light absorption and decrease representation. Collectively, these innovative products not just add to greater power effectiveness but additionally lead the way for more functional solar applications, making solar energy an extra practical alternative for organizations and consumers alike.

Exactly How Do Solar Panels Job to Create Electrical Power?



Solar panels create electrical energy by converting sunshine right into direct current (DC) making use of solar batteries. An inverter after that transforms this DC right into alternating present (A/C), which can be utilized to power homes and services.


What Is the Average Lifespan of Solar Panels?



The ordinary life expectancy of solar panels commonly varies between 25 to three decades. Lots of panels continue to operate beyond this timeframe, frequently experiencing a progressive decline in performance instead than complete failing.

Can Solar Panels Be Installed on Any Type Of Kind of Roofing system?



Solar panels can be set up on most sorts of roof coverings, including asphalt roof shingles, steel, and flat surface areas. However, the roofing's positioning, angle, and structural integrity substantially affect the installation process and general effectiveness.


What Happens if My Solar Panels Create Excess Power?



If solar panels generate excess power, home owners can typically market it back to the grid, gaining from internet metering. Solar Company. This process permits them to obtain credit histories or monetary settlement for the excess power created
